American Legion Post #459

658 Michigan NE-Grand Rapids, Mi.   Phone (616)  458-3929

American Legion Post #459 is private club located at 658 Michigan NE.  It is very easy to become a member as long as you are eligible.  Eligibility requirements are list below.  We encourage you to stop by and check us out as we strive to increase our membership as much as we can.  We always have a great time at #459.  Our big events of each year include our Pulaski Days celebration, our New Year's Eve party, our Valentine's Day Prime Rib Dinner, and our Spring Kickoff BBQ.  We also have daily food specials including 25 cent hot dogs on Wednesdays.  We often have drink specials especially during sporting events such as NASCAR races.  We generally have Karaoke every Friday and Saturday and have live music periodically as well.  The other, and most important, benefit of membership at #459 is the opportunity for service to our veterans, children, and community.  The membership of post #459 is dedicated to this very rewarding endeavor.  If you have any questions, please feel free to contact SAL Commander Brad Koch at 616-458-9329 or bkoch@khps.org.


Eligibility requirements: American Legion --Service in armed forces during at least one day within the following dates ranges:

April 6, 1917 to November 11, 1918                         June 25, 1950 to January 31, 1955

December 7, 1941 to December 31, 1946                 February 28, 1961 to May 7, 1975

August 24, 1982 to July 31 1984                                December 20, 1989 to January 31, 1990

          August 2, 1990 to Open


Sons of the American Legion:

(1.) Be a male descendant (includes stepsons and adopted sons) of member of the American Legion. (2.) Be the male descendant (stepsons and adopted sons included) of a veteran who died in service during World War I, World War II, the Korean War, Vietnam War, Lebanon, Grenada, Panama, or the Persian Gulf War. (3.) Be the male descendant (stepsons and adopted sons included) of a veteran who died subsequent to his or her honorable discharge from service in  World War I, World War II, the Korean War, Vietnam War, Lebanon, Grenada, Panama, or the Persian Gulf War.


Ladies Auxiliary:

Membership in the Auxiliary is limited to a woman who have direct personal connection with service in World I, World War II, the Korean War, Vietnam War, Lebanon, Grenada, Panama, or the Persian Gulf War. This service is through a member of one's own immediate family who served in the Armed Forces during those wars or conflicts, or through one's own service with the Armed Forces.
